### Account Recovery — Catalogue Import (Lintwood)

Quick one for review: when the Lintwood catalogue import wipes a patron's session table, the recovery flow re-seeds accounts from the nightly snapshot. Check that the importer skips locked accounts — last time it didn't. To rerun recovery against staging you'll need the vault passphrase, which is appended just below.

recovery phrase for yafof-tajof: julmir-kelax-julvan-holath-belvan-holir-ralael-ralvan-ralath-julvan-silmir-istmir-kaswyn-ulamir

Ticket: Flaky integration tests in Ledgerpine payments service. The suite intermittently fails on connection timeouts during the refund-batch step, roughly 1 in 6 runs on the Fernmont CI pool. Retries mask it; don't add more. Suspect the test harness opens a stale pool before teardown finishes. To reproduce locally, run the refund suite against the shared staging database, connecting with the string below.

replica DSN, tawef-hahap: mysql://eliix_svc:FiIC0jz@db-394a.lumiclabs.internal:5432/holius

## Runbook: Thimbleshear batch resizer

The CLI processes queued image jobs in fixed-size batches and writes results to the staging bucket before promotion. If a batch stalls, inspect the worker log for decode errors before retrying — partial batches must never be promoted. All runtime behavior is driven by a single configuration file loaded at startup, reproduced here for maintainers:

service settings:
[casax]
port = 6379
team = rusir
host = casax.zemvarhq.corp
region = outer-4
access_code = ac_9808ce
timeout_ms = 1500